General Information about #274810
The hexadecimal color code #274810 represents a dark shade of green, often associated with nature, growth, and stability. In the RGB color model, it consists of 15.29% red, 28.24% green, and 6.27% blue. This particular shade evokes a sense of earthiness and can be perceived as calming and grounding. Colors like #274810 are often used in designs aiming to create a natural or organic feel. It's important to note that due to its darkness, it may require careful consideration regarding color contrast to ensure readability and accessibility. Lighter colors are generally recommended for text or foreground elements when using #274810 as a background.
The color #274810, a dark shade of green, presents some accessibility challenges, particularly concerning color contrast. When used as a background color, it's crucial to pair it with text that is sufficiently light to ensure readability. A light gray, white, or even a pale yellow could work well as text colors. According to WCAG (Web Content Accessibility Guidelines), the contrast ratio between text and background should be at least 4.5:1 for normal text and 3:1 for large text to meet AA standards. For AAA standards, these ratios increase to 7:1 and 4.5:1, respectively. Tools are available online to check the contrast ratio between two colors. Using color alone to convey important information should be avoided, as users with color vision deficiencies may not be able to distinguish the color properly. Instead, use additional cues such as text labels or icons.

Web Design for Nature-Related Sites
In web design, #274810 can be used as a primary color for websites related to nature, gardening, or environmental organizations. It evokes feelings of growth, stability, and sustainability. It can be used for website headers, borders, or subtle background elements. Combining it with lighter greens or natural browns can create a harmonious and visually appealing color palette. Furthermore, #274810 can be effective in infographics to represent data related to agriculture or forestry. However, because it is a dark color, it is very important to be mindful of color contrast with text and other elements to make sure it is still accessible.
Interior Design Accent Color
In interior design, #274810 can be used as an accent color in rooms to bring a touch of nature indoors. It could be used for painting a feature wall or selecting furniture upholstery. It pairs well with natural materials like wood and stone, creating a calming and grounded atmosphere. Additionally, #274810 can be incorporated into textiles such as curtains or cushions. It adds depth to a space when combined with neutral colors such as beige or gray. This shade of green can evoke a feeling of serenity and connection to the environment.
